CHEBI:73718 - tridecanedioic acid
Main
ChEBI Ontology
Automatic Xrefs
Reactions
Pathways
Models
ChEBI Name
tridecanedioic acid
ChEBI ID
CHEBI:73718
Definition
An α,ω-dicarboxylic acid that is undecane substituted by carboxylic acid groups at positions C-1 and C-11.
